Question: Schottky defect in crystals is observed when

[CBSE PMT 1998; KCET 2002]

Options:

A) Density of crystal is increased

B) Unequal number of cations and anions are missing from the lattice

C) An ion leaves its normal site and occupies an interstitial site

D) Equal number of cations and anions are missing from the lattice

Show Answer

Answer:

Correct Answer: D

Solution:

Schottky defect is due to missing of equal number of cations and anions.
